Dealing with transition metal complexes the synthesis can not only focus on how to put together metals and ligands, but at least three important variables, defining the final complex and its specific properties, have to be considered: the oxidation state, the coordination number, and the coordination geometry of the complexed metal ion. The N-heterocyclic silylene (NHSi) [Ph 2 P(t BuN) 2]SiCl (1), supported by an iminophosphonamide ligand, was obtained from the dehydrochlorination of [Ph 2 P(t BuN) 2]SiHCl 2 (2) with LiN(SiMe 3) 2.NHSi 1 contains an extremely high-energy HOMO level and consequently displays unique coordination behavior toward Rh I complexes.
